Abstract

The present invention relates to a refrigerator provided with an electronic memo board. A memo board disposed on a front surface of a door of the refrigerator and providing an electronic note board in the form of a rectangular plate capable of taking notes; A starter mounted on a handle of the refrigerator door and generating a signal for touching the memo board when the user holds the handle; And an input unit for memorizing desired contents in the electronic memo while the memo mode is activated by the activation unit.
The present invention as described above makes it possible for anyone to leave a memo in a simple manner and to carry out a memo transfer function between a family member who does not have much time to communicate with each other in a busy life, It is possible to maintain the appearance of the refrigerator neatly and to operate when the door of the refrigerator is opened by holding the handle and equipped with a motion sensor on the handle of the refrigerator. Thereby, fingerprint or voice is registered as necessary, You can avoid writing or reading this memo, and furthermore, you can draw or write the number and directions of the nearby delivery restaurants, the number of times using the delivery food, and the characteristics and kindness of the delivery restaurant in analog manner. .

[0001] The present invention relates to a refrigerator having an electronic memo board,

The present invention relates to a refrigerator provided with an electronic memo board.

Refrigerators for storing various kinds of foods, foods, drinks and medicines at low temperatures to keep them cool or decay are indispensable electronic products in our daily lives, ranging from restaurants, offices, and laboratories to almost every home.

Such a refrigerator has various kinds designed to maintain the temperature and moisture most suitable for storing a specific article, for example, a Kimchi refrigerator, a wine refrigerator, a flower refrigerator, a cosmetic refrigerator, and the like have been developed.

In particular, with the recent advancement of communication and electronic technologies, the penetration rate of the Internet has increased, and it has become possible to control the refrigerator through the Internet by connecting a computer to the refrigerator. This so-called Internet refrigerator has devices such as a display unit and a touch pad outside the refrigerator. The device is also connected to a microcomputer in the refrigerator to control the operation of the refrigerator.

For example, in Korean Patent Laid-Open Publication No. 10-2008-0099669 (a display method of a touch screen and a refrigerator using the same), a touch screen extending vertically and long is installed on a front surface of a refrigerator. The touch screen serves to input or output various information.

However, the above-described conventional refrigerator uses a touch screen for the Internet in a refrigerator, but it has a disadvantage in that its usefulness is not good. While it may be possible to obtain information on products through the Internet or to manage the inventory of food in the refrigerator, this is a very cumbersome task, and it is seldom possible to actually use the Internet to manage inventory during busy daily life. Moreover, most housewives who are tired of housework do not have any willingness to use it, no matter how good the device is. As a result, the above-described conventional Internet refrigerator has a disadvantage in that it is extremely ineffective in price.

On the other hand, in the case of a typical home, various kinds of magnetic advertisement are attached to the door of the refrigerator. Such attachments are used for temporarily attaching a simple note pad or the like to the refrigerator. However, if you attach several magnetic attachments to the refrigerator, the aesthetics are not good and they become dirty and, in some cases, the notes may disappear.

The present invention is designed to solve the above problems. Anyone can leave a memo in a simple manner, so that it is possible to carry out a memo transfer function between a family member who does not have much time to talk together in a busy life, And it is an object of the present invention to provide a refrigerator equipped with an electronic memo board which can maintain the appearance of the refrigerator neatly.

It is another object of the present invention to provide a refrigerator equipped with an electronic memo board which is free from standby power consumption because the electronic still function operates when a door of a refrigerator is opened by holding a handle with a motion sensor on the handle of the refrigerator.

It is another object of the present invention to provide a refrigerator equipped with an electronic memo board which can register fingerprints or voices as needed to prevent unregistered persons from writing or reading memos.

In addition, the present invention can be used to draw or write the telephone number of the nearby delivery restaurant, the number of times of using the route or the delivery food, and the characteristics and kindness of the delivery restaurant in an analog manner, so that a refrigerator equipped with an electronic memo board The purpose is to provide.

In order to achieve the above-mentioned object, a refrigerator provided with an electronic memo board according to the present invention includes: a door disposed in front of a door of a refrigerator and provided with a rectangular plate-shaped electronic memo Board; A starter mounted on a handle of the refrigerator door and generating a signal for touching the memo board when the user holds the handle; And an input unit for memorizing desired contents in the electronic memo while the memo mode is activated by the activation unit.

The memo board may further include: A control unit connected to the receiving unit and adapted to receive a signal transmitted from the receiving unit and generate a control signal; and a memory that is controlled by the control unit and stores information input by using the input unit, And a display unit which is controlled by the control unit and outputs contents stored in the memory unit and contents inputted through the input unit through the electronic memo.

The input unit may further include: A case which is fixed to a side of the electronic memo plate and provides a storage space; and a touch fan which is stored in the case and which is held by a worker in a hand and held by a hand during use.

Further, the handle is configured such that both ends thereof are fixed to the door of the refrigerator, and the center portion is separated from the door so that the hand can be inserted behind the handle. A second touch sensor provided on a rear surface of the handle and opposite to the door, a fingerprint recognition unit positioned below the first touch sensor on the front surface of the handle and recognizing the fingerprint of the user, And a voice recognition unit provided on the first touch sensor and recognizing the user's voice.

The refrigerator provided with the electronic memo board of the present invention as described above can leave a note in a simple manner by anyone and can perform a function of transferring a memo between family members who do not have much time to talk together during their busy life, Since it is unnecessary to use the magnet attachment, the appearance of the refrigerator can be maintained neatly and the operation sensor is provided on the handle of the refrigerator to operate when opening the door of the refrigerator by holding the handle, so there is no standby power consumption, To prevent unauthorized persons from writing or reading a memo. Further, the number of the nearby delivery restaurant, the number of times of using the route or delivery food, and the characteristic and kindness of the delivery restaurant are analogized Or it can be written down.

Hereinafter, one embodiment according to the present invention will be described in detail with reference to the accompanying drawings.

Basically, the refrigerator equipped with the electronic memo board according to the present embodiment is not a refrigerator which stores and cures food or food but is equipped with a high-specification computer which is not necessary and which is high in price, but also housewives, children, It is also possible to use a memo board that can be used easily so that the refrigerator can be used as a communication channel for exchanging memos even if there is little time for conversation.

Especially, it is possible to write a memo board with pictures, maps or greetings in a handwritten form so that more memorable memos can be delivered. For example, a father who comes to work at dawn can give a note of cheering to his children or write something to eat in the refrigerator.

Alternatively, the housewife may take notes on the memo board when there is no place for a sudden note during a call, and may even write down the telephone number, characteristics or kindness of the nearby delivery restaurant.

Particularly, the refrigerator provided with the electronic memo board according to the present embodiment has a sensor for starting the memo board and is activated when the sensor is touched and automatically turned off after the set time, No one (for example, when several people use the refrigerator in the same place as a food factory) can not see the passerby.

Hereinafter, a refrigerator including the electronic memo board according to the present embodiment will be described with reference to the following description.

1 is a view for explaining a configuration of a refrigerator 11 provided with an electronic memo board according to an embodiment of the present invention.

As shown in the figure, a refrigerator 11 equipped with an electronic memo board according to the present embodiment includes a memo board 27 disposed on a front surface of a door 13 of a refrigerator, And an input unit for writing the desired contents to the memo board 27. The input unit is provided with a plurality of sensors,

First, in the present embodiment, the refrigerator 11 is a side-by-side refrigerator, and a handle 15 is fixed to each of the doors 13 on both sides. The handle 15 is of a type in which the upper and lower ends of the handle 15 are fixed to the door 13 and the center portion of the handle 15 is floated from the door 13 so that a hand can be inserted behind the handle.

The first and second touch sensors 17 and 19, the fingerprint recognition unit 21 and the voice recognition unit 23 are disposed on the handle 15. The first and second touch sensors 17 and 19, the fingerprint recognition unit 21 and the voice recognition unit 23 have a parallel relationship and serve as an activation unit for activating the memo board 27.

The first touch sensor 17, the second touch sensor 19, the fingerprint recognition unit 21, and the voice recognition unit 23 can be selectively applied according to the embodiment. For example, one application may be applied, or two or more may be used in combination.

The feature of the refrigerator of the present embodiment is that the starter is provided on the handle 15. That is, the memo board 27 is turned on even if only the handle is held by hand. This means that the elderly or children can easily use the memo board (27).

In the present specification, the handle 15 is fixed to the door 13 at both ends, but the shape of the handle is different according to the design of the refrigerator. That is, if the first and second touch sensors 17 and 19, the fingerprint recognition unit 21, and the voice recognition unit 23 can be installed, the shape of the handle may vary.

The first touch sensor 17 and the second touch sensor 19 are touched when the user holds the refrigerator by hand and generate a signal. The sensing methods of the first and second touch sensors 17 and 19 are the same as those of the conventional touch sensor.

Particularly, the first touch sensor 17 is located at the front side of the handle 15, and the second touch sensor 19 is disposed at the rear side of the handle 15, both of which are extended vertically.

The first touch sensor 17 is operated when the user presses the front of the knob 15 anywhere and the second touch sensor 19 is operated when the user grips the knob 15 anywhere with the finger, The moment when the force is applied to open. There is no need to find a switch for turning on the memo board 27.

In addition, the one-side knob 15 is provided with a fingerprint recognition unit 21 and a voice recognition unit 23. The fingerprint recognition unit 21 is a unit for recognizing a fingerprint of a person using a refrigerator. For example, when a refrigerator is shared by a plurality of people, such as a boarding house, a study room, a catering establishment, etc., the fingerprint can be stored in advance so that only a specific person can use the memo board 27.

Likewise, the voice recognition unit 23 stores a voice of a person for using the memo board 27. When a specific person commands the operation of the memo board 27, the voice recognition unit 23 recognizes the voice of the person, 27).

The sensing signals output from the first and second touch sensors 17 and 19, the fingerprint recognition unit 21 and the voice recognition unit 23 are transmitted to the reception unit 35 of FIG. 2 inside the memo board 27 And the control unit 37 connected to the receiving unit 35 is operated.

On the other hand, the memo board 27 has an electronic memo board 27 which provides a rectangular area in which various memos can be written. The electronic note board 27 is a so-called touch pad that operates when the memo board 27 is activated by the activation of the activation unit to display a memo written on its surface.

The input method of the electronic note board 27 may be a depressurization type, an electrostatic type or an electromagnetic induction type.

The memo board 27 is provided with a receiving unit 35, a control unit 37, a memory unit 41 and a display unit 39 as shown in FIG. The receiving unit 35 receives signals transmitted from the activating unit, that is, the first and second touch sensors 17 and 19 or the fingerprint recognizing unit 21 or the voice recognizing unit 23,

The control unit 37 receives contents inputted by the user through an input unit to be described later and transmits the contents to the memory unit 41 and sends the contents to the display unit 39 so that the contents written by the user can be viewed in real time or already written Let the contents be retrieved.

Particularly, when there is no memo on the memo board 27, the memo board 27 does not operate even if the starter operates. In addition, when there is no memorized content, a clock, a company logo, or the like can be displayed on the memo board.

The operation of the memo board 27 will be described later with reference to FIG.

Reference numeral 25 denotes a home bar door. The home bar door 25 is, for example, a door for taking out a simple drink or the like stored in the refrigerator.

On the other hand, a case 29 and an input pen 31 are provided on the side of the electronic note board 27a. The input pen 31 serves as an input unit in the refrigerator 11 of the present embodiment as a touch pen type writing means for the user to grasp the pencil as if holding a pencil and write a memo necessary for the electronic note board 27a.

In addition, the case 29 is an upper opened barrel and receives the input pen 31 therein. The case 29 may be completely fixed to the door or side wall of the refrigerator, or may be movably attached thereto. It is preferable that the input pen 31 is fixed to the side wall so that the input pen 31 can always be found at a designated point.

2 is a block diagram for explaining a driving method of a refrigerator 11 equipped with an electronic memo board according to an embodiment of the present invention. It is a matter of course that the refrigerator 11 has a basic function of refrigerating and storing frozen foods, foods and the like in the same manner as a general refrigerator.

In order to use the memo board 27, first and second touch sensors 17 and 19 provided on the handle 15 are touched. Of course, when the fingerprint is registered, the finger is placed on the fingerprint recognition unit 21, and when the voice is registered, the start of the memo board 27 is instructed by voice.

The registered voice signal may be, for example, a general name such as "memo", "refrigerator", or the user's name. Whatever the voice signal is, the memo board 27 is activated when the user shouts the registered voice in front of the refrigerator 11. [

As described above, the first and second touch sensors 17 and 19, the fingerprint recognition unit 21 and the voice recognition unit 23 have a parallel structure with respect to the memo board 27. This means that the memo mode 27 can be activated by using either the first touch sensor 17 or the second touch sensor 19 or the fingerprint recognition unit 21 or the voice recognition unit 23.

In any case, when the user activates the activation sections (including 17, 19, 21, and 23), the activation section causes the control section 37 constituting the memo board 27 to activate the memo board 27. The activated state is a state in which desired contents can be written on the electronic note board 27a.

If the memo board 27 is activated through the above process, the user inputs desired contents to the electronic memo board 27a using the input unit 33. [ That is, the user holds the input pen 31 in his / her hand and writes a desired picture or text.

The content input to the electronic memo 27a by the input pen 31 is transmitted to the control unit 37 via the receiving unit 35. The control unit 37 stores the input contents in the memory unit 41, (39). The user can confirm the contents to be written by himself / herself through the electronic memo board 27a.

When the above process is completed, the memo board 27 is turned off after about 10 seconds to one minute, for example, when the input content is stored in the memory unit 41. It is a matter of course that the input contents are displayed on the electronic memo board 27a again when another person operates the activation unit.
